Rising Demand for Fertility Treatments
The increasing demand for fertility treatments among women diagnosed with polycystic ovarian syndrome is a notable driver for the polycystic ovarian-syndrome market. PCOS is a leading cause of infertility, and as awareness of this condition grows, more women are seeking assistance to conceive. In France, the fertility treatment market has seen a surge, with a reported growth rate of around 5% annually. This trend is likely to continue as more women are diagnosed with PCOS and seek specialized care. The polycystic ovarian-syndrome market is expected to expand in response to this demand, as healthcare providers develop targeted therapies and interventions to assist women in achieving their reproductive goals.

Increasing Incidence of Polycystic Ovarian Syndrome
The rising incidence of polycystic ovarian syndrome (PCOS) in France is a critical driver for the polycystic ovarian-syndrome market. Recent studies indicate that approximately 10% of women of reproductive age are affected by this condition, leading to a growing demand for effective treatment options. The increasing prevalence of obesity and sedentary lifestyles among the population further exacerbates the situation, as these factors are closely linked to the development of PCOS. Consequently, healthcare providers are focusing on early diagnosis and management strategies, which is likely to boost the market. The polycystic ovarian-syndrome market is expected to expand as more women seek medical assistance and treatment, thereby increasing the overall market value.
